Hornady FTX projectiles have actually revolutionized ballistics particularly for Lever Action firearms. The patented flex tip design provides sportsmen with a whole new level of performance breathing new life into these popular firearms. Hornady FTX projectiles will afford you accuracy, power and long range performance rarely seen in other lever action cartridges. The polymer tip ensures that the projectile is safe to load in tubular magazines. The Hornady FTX is the perfect pairing for your favorite lever action gun!
Note: These are projectiles only. They are used for loading or reloading empty shell cases. This is not finished ammunition that is ready to fire.
Specifications and Features:
Hornady FTX Reloading Projectiles 35105
.35 Caliber
.35 Remington
.358" Diameter
200 Grain FTX Polymer Tip Flat Base
Cannelure
Non-Coated
G1 Ballistic Coefficient .300
Sectional Density .223
100 Projectiles per box

I am using a Marlin lever gun in 35 Remington. I switched from 200 grain round nose to 200 grain flex tip and the performance gain was absolutely awesome. One 75 yard shot left animal dead in its tracks with a 3' exit wound. Another deer in the freezer. This bullet will hold 1' at a hundred not bad for a lever gun made in 1957.

How would these do in a 35 whelen?
Answer:
These projectiles are compatible with 35 Whelen. I have not seen Hornady using these exact heads in their factory ammunition and I am not seeing much online discussion regarding how these bullets perform in 35 Whelen. However, Barnes and Nosler use similar bullets with same grain weight and polymer tips in their factory 35 Whelen ammo, so this will likely work well.
